Golamunda in context

With 1,288 people at the 2011 Census, Golamunda was the 340th most populous of its district's 2253 villages, above the district average of 646.

Literacy stood at 65.33%, 8.1 points above the district's rural average of 57.28%.

The sex ratio was 886 women per 1,000 men (122 below the district's rural figure of 1008). Among children aged 0–6 the ratio was 1075, 152 above the rural national 923.
